Description:

In this course, you will care for persons requiring support with complex and co-morbid clinical conditions in a local healthcare setting or a setting focused on addressing health conditions from a global perspective. You will enhance your ability to develop therapeutic nurse-client relationships framed within the College of Nurses of Ontario's (CNO's) values of client well-being, client choice, privacy and confidentiality, respect for life, maintaining commitments, truthfulness, and fairness. Your healthcare experience will culminate in a capstone project. To complete the capstone project, you will use current research evidence and best practices to prepare an in-depth analysis of a healthcare organization's current problems, potential solutions, and an implementation plan. The solutions and implementation plan will consolidate the knowledge, skills, and judgement you have acquired throughout the program.
